The distinctive qualities of African music were not appreciated or even ________ by Westerners until fairly recently. ​


Two Answers
deprecated
discerned
ignored
reverend
remarked on
neglected


Why not option D , as reverend also means to show reverence ( or huge respect ) ?

So basically, The distinct qualities of African music were not appreciated or even "respected" by .....


Hi There!

Lets start by pairing the words:
-deprecated- express disapproval
-Discerned & Remarked on- to see or notice something with difficulty
-Ignored & neglected
-Reverend- high respect

Now, from the above we know deprecated & reverend do not form a necessary match and could be negated.
From the sentence given, The distinctive qualities of African music were not appreciated or even ________ by Westerners until fairly recently. ​
As, it was not appreciated, it cannot be ignored. Because if the Westerners ignored it doesn't make sense. Thus, only Discerned & Remarked on fits the bill.

IMO B & E.
